{"area_code":"800","is_legitimate_code":true,"explanation":"Area code 800 is a legitimate toll-free code. It is not a scam by itself, though such codes are commonly used in robocalls and can be spoofed.","spoofing_note":"An area code only shows where a number is registered, not who is calling.
